City of St. Paul, MN Grant Number B-80-AA-27-00�+9(7) Pro�ect Name: St. Paul Union Depot Pursuant to the preliminary approval your City received for an Urban Development Action Grant for the above pro,ject in.the amount of $858,000, I am pleased to forward for your signature four (4) copies o�' the Grant Agreement setting forth the terms and conditions of the Grant. I have signed � the Signature Page of all copies. If the Gra.nt Agreement meets with your approval, kind],y si� all four (�+) copies on the line indicated on the Signature Page. When you have signed the copies of the Grant Agreement, please forward two (2) executed duplicate originals of the Grant Agree�nt to the HUD Area . - Office. The Area Office will then complete the processing of the Grant. - Also, one (1) executed duplicate original af the Grant Agreement should be iffinediately forwarded to: U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development Office of Urban Development Action Grants �+51 Seventh Street, S.W. , Room 7258 Washington, DC 201+10 � Your attention is particular]y directed to Exhibits E and F of the Grant Agreement. Exhibit E sets forth the required evidentiary materials which must be submitted and accepted prior to the use of grant �l.inds and Exhibit F sets forth the performa.nce schedule. You will note that the drawdown of ftiinds from the Letter of Credit is conditioned upon the prior submission and acceptance by HUD of certain evidentiary materials relating to the required co�itments. , ,�` . .� . � . �r��g� . � . . 2 While the execution of the Grant A eement by flUD oblig�tes the grant i�inds for this pro�ect in the amoun s a ed�ve, it does not automa.tical],y . authorize disbursement of the grant �funds. Authority for the actual drawdown . o� ar�p grant t�ands a�.inst your Zetter of Credit is contingent upon yaur meeting conditions set forth in the Grant A eement. Un].ess otherwiee provided for in the Grant Agreement, no costs may e reimbursed out of grant ftuids until all environmental clearances have been completed and the conditions in the Grant A�eement have been met to HUD's satis�action. When requesting the drawdown of Grant Funds, you should use the complete� Grant Number, including the digit within the parenthesis. . You should also be aware tha.t 2¢ CFR Section 570.461 (f) of the Action Grant program regulations published on February 23, 1982 requires submission o� quarterly progress reports. Such reports are due at HUD Headquarters and at the HUD Area Office servicing your project on January 10, April 10, July 10 and October 10 0� each year until the Closeout Agreement for your project has been signed by you and by the T3UD Area Office concerned and received by our Action Grant o�fice. There are two major sections to the quarterl,y progress report: Part I which is computer-generated at HUD and sent to your project conta,ct person two weeks before the end of each quarter; and Parts II through VII on which you provide the latest narrative information on specified topics. Deta.iled instructions and an initial supply of narrative forms axe enclosed. .
